First off - LOVE the app. We have been using for daughter's HS and travel teams for past 3 seasons and the coaches are blown away with all the info and the parents love the scorecasting feature. Unfortunately, I hit a snag that I haven't seen discussed on any previous posts.
The travel coach asked if he could get the previous year's stats on our team website since we were only showing the current year. The first issue was that I had setup a new team for this spring/summer season as the team tied to the team website, and simply changed the team name for last season from "Team" to "Team 2013". I then read about the team merge feature and how to use the active/inactive player mode in the team roster, and figured that would solve my problem to be able to show stats from both years. It worked like a charm except I have one player from last season that was merged into a different current player - different names, numbers, etc...so I have no idea why this happened. When I go back and update the correct player in the starting lineup of the first game of last season in Game Manager, the correction is made but continues through the entire player history for both seasons. The problem is that my original player from last season no longer even appears in my Player Manager list or Team Roster. If I manually change in Game Manager, it changes all games for both seasons. Any ideas what happened? I'm hoping the fix is somewhat simple since my player from last season is no longer on the team and the current player was not on the team last year so it is easy to identify what stats belong to which player. Once players are merged into a single player, all data about the players is treated as the same player in iScore, so there is not a way to "split" a player.
You can however create the missing player, and add the player to the Team Roster. Then you can go to the games that player was supposed to appear in, and remove the incorrect player from the lineup for those games, and add the new player in that player's place. You will have to do it for each game, and be sure to "sub in" the player as needed if they ever came in off the bench.

Understand. I guess what has me perplexed is why two unique players were merged into a single player? There names and numbers are not the same, and each played in different seasons. I just want to make sure there is not a bigger issue here with the Team Merge feature.
